First, understanding the worms is essential. Roundworms, tapeworms, hookworms—each behaves differently. A kitten with visible segments in its stool isn’t just disgusting; it’s a biological red flag. Roundworms, for instance, can grow up to seven inches, embedding larvae in tissues and potentially impacting brain development if untreated. Tapeworms, though less immediately dangerous, signal poor hygiene or flea infestation—an ecosystem failure in miniature. Yet many owners treat these with generic dewormers without knowing which parasite they’re battling. This is a critical gap. Misdiagnosis leads to treatment resistance and prolonged suffering.

The first debate centers on treatment choice. Over-the-counter dewormers, widely accessible, often miss mixed infections. Veterinarians emphasize targeted therapy: fecal tests reveal up to 40% of kittens carry multiple parasite species. A one-size-fits-all approach risks incomplete clearance. But access to diagnostics remains uneven. In low-resource regions, owners rely on symptoms alone—prompting repeated, ineffective treatments that foster drug resistance. It’s a cycle: symptoms prompt drugs, resistance emerges, and the worm outmaneuvers the cure.

Then there’s the logistical and emotional toll. Deworming protocols require strict compliance—multiple doses over weeks, strict isolation from other pets, and rigorous sanitation. A kitten sheds eggs in its environment at a rate that makes room disinfection a constant battle. One case study from a UK feline clinic documented a 60% reinfection rate within three months, largely due to inadequate cleaning. Owners often underestimate this invisible burden, expecting a single pill to fix what’s actually a systemic issue.

Public health concerns add another layer. Zoonotic transmission—especially with Toxocara and Toxascaris—means a kitten’s infestation can affect children and immunocompromised individuals. This raises the stakes beyond pet health: untreated worms pose real public risk. Yet many owners remain unaware of this crossover, treating the kitten as a private matter rather than a community health node. Ultimately, the most effective response hinges on a dual strategy: precision medicine paired with environmental stewardship. First, insist on fecal testing—not just a routine check, but a targeted analysis to identify species and resistance patterns. Second, implement rigorous hygiene: daily litter box cleaning, disinfection with ammonia-based solutions (effective against most feline parasites), and flea control to break transmission chains. These steps transform reactive treatment into proactive prevention.
